Alright. I'll come out and say it. I'm a text-oholic. I'm currently with Cingular/AT&T (whatever they call themselves now) and am desperately wanting a phone with a decent size QWERTY interface. I currently use a Samsung SYNC and simply want something designed for texting. I'm more than willing to change providers (min has been...let's say "subpar" as of late) and want to know what my options would be for the cream o' the crop QWERTY based phones. I'm currently looking at T-Mobile's Sidekick series, and have heard many mixed reviews on each.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ated. If you have the time, please list your suggested phone and it's capabilities. If not, the name and provider will be just fine. I'm sorry if this post sounds demanding, I've just been to too many sites looking at reviews and want to know other people's opinions and preferences over others, besides just their favorite things about that phone are. Thanks in advance.

Re: Top Texting Phone?
Since you're on ATT, I'd suggest trying the Blackjack, E62, or any of the Blackberrys that they carry. If you're willing to spend a little extra money, try looking at **** for some unlocked phones. Just make sure that it has the 850 mHz band on it.
